
Chatham resident Sally Helgesen, whose latest book, The Female Vision: Women's Real Power in the Workplace, published just last week and already #2 on Amazon's Business and Leadership list, had a reading and signing at the Chatham Bookstore on Saturday, June 19. Helgesen's selection dealt with the financial meltdown of 2008, and the win-short-term-at-any-cost ethic that effectively barred all women (and the kind of men) who are prone to look at the big, long-term picture from leadership roles in the hedge fund and banking industries.
